I am a British ex-pat living in France. I write in English with the view of (hopefully) being published in the UK. Often I find that publishers and competitions calling for fiction subs stipulate they want UK residents only. Why is this? Is my living abroad going to be a constant block to my possible publishing success? Do publishers and/or agents accept authors from abroad?

I am an American living in Malaysia. I haven't had a chance yet to test the publication waters, but I have had a few issues with this for freelance work. I was told that as long as I am still an American citizen (which I am), I am still eligible. I just send a copy of my passport as proof.

As for contests and such, I have posted material on several different sites without issue. I do however read the stipulations carefully for each site and only send to the ones that do not mention a resident requirement. My current targets are literary magazines. Just search for those that accept online submissions and you're all set. Some pay quite well, and exposure in any form is a good thing.
